I hardly ever weld stainless steel with my little MIG welder. Ernie
says if I use C25 gas mix the weld will be OK but will need wire
brushing for cosmetics. So I try C25 but the welds look like ****.
Ropy and lots of oxidation. And the wire won't come out right. And I
keep getting burn back. So I finish the gas mixing manifold so that I
can get just 3% CO2 in the mix. Welds still look like ****! Thinking
that maybe the gas isn't getting mixed well enough in the mixer I make
a new one. No help. And not only does the wire keep burning back but
the contact tip is getting red hot! Now, you may think I'm stupid
because I didn't check the welder setup to make sure the polarity was
correct before starting. Well, I'm not stupid for that reason because
I did check the polarity. I'm stupid because I have spent hours trying
everything to get good welds. Stupid because even though I checked the
polarity and compared the cable connections to the diagram inside the
welder cover I STILL GOT IT WRONG! Stupid because I have had the cover
open so I could keep checking the setting of wire and feed and
comparing them to the chart inside the cover. This means that every
time I looked at the welder I could see that the polarity was wrong,
but didn't. Finally, frustrated, I sat down and stared at the welder.
And see the polarity is wrong. Anyway, I'm getting good welds now.
Almost looks like I know what I'm doing.
